IT and outsourcing services for Criminal Justice
 
Steria is delivering some of the most influential projects to modernise and extend the role of IT across the Criminal Justice System.

We have extensive experience of delivering practical IT and business solutions to support the tough challenges faced by today’s criminal justice agencies, such as how to achieve joined-up service delivery, transform process efficiency and reduce re-offending.

  • Managed infrastructure services – we design, deliver and manage complex ICT infrastructures and are a partner in the £2 billion Joined-up Justice programme. Our delivery of a single network is transforming the way in which multiple agencies store and exchange information. 
  • Information management – we’re enabling informed organisational decision-making, improving risk management and supporting a joined-up approach to criminal justice with complex web-based case tracking systems and shared access to a single source of data.
  • Back office efficiency – our business process outsourcing (BPO) services have helped organisations reduce operating costs by more than 40%, money that can then be reinvested in delivering performance improvements in core service delivery.
  • Transformation – from project and change management, security consultancy and market analysis, through to architecture design, testing and system tuning, we’re helping to drive the efficiencies that are streamlining processes and ensuring criminals are quickly brought to justice.

Offender Management National Infrastructure  (OMNI)

Steria is helping the Ministry of Justice’s National Offender Management Service to better integrate with prisons and to support end to end offender management. Providing national support for 43 local datacentres and upgrading services to improve performance and business continuity, full user access across areas, better support, national reporting to enable solutions to be prioritised, reduced costs and a platform for the introduction of a national case management system (which Steria is also delivering).


The Criminal Justice Exchange

The Criminal Justice Exchange (CJX) is a common secure infrastructure that enables Criminal Justice Service organisations and agencies to share knowledge and information efficiently, effectively and securely. It is central to the achievement of the goals of the CJS modernisation programme.

Sensitive information can be shared online, quickly, easily and accurately, while the inefficiencies of multiple agencies producing duplicate information can be avoided, supporting a range of efficiency-focused change programmes such as Bichard 7. There is potential for the CJX to be used across other government departments.


Criminal Cases Review Commission (CCRC)

Within the Criminal Justice System we are supporting the virtualisation of the server estate for the Criminal Cases Review Commission (CCRC) as part of a long-term strategic partnership extending back over 10 years. This is dramatically reducing the CCRC’s physical footprint and is yielding more efficient ways of working. Virtualisation has the added benefit of supporting one of the key performance indicators of the Greening of Government ICT strategy; that of increasing average server capacity utilisation by a minimum of 50%.

The virtualisation programme is very much in line with our commitment to providing IT managed services that focus on improving service delivery and maximising efficiency in support of the CCRC’s determination to ensure all cases are dealt with effectively and expeditiously.
